From: Kris Van Hees Date: Mon, 6 Aug 2012 09:01:08 +0000 (-0400) Subject: dtrace: new IO and sched provider probes X-Git-Tag: v4.1.12-92~313^2~131 X-Git-Url: https://www.infradead.org/git/?a=commitdiff_plain;h=88a948fb33e613462b09a1047ab5adb87311ca02;p=users%2Fjedix%2Flinux-maple.git dtrace: new IO and sched provider probes New IO provider probes: start, done, wait-start, wait-done New sched provider probes: enqueue, dequeue, wakeup, preempt, remain-cpu, change-pri, surrender (Note that the preempt probe currently passes a debugging argument that will be removed in the future to match the argument-less version in the documentation.)
